The story of Willis Hardwick began in 1786 in Virginia, United States. In 1840, Willis Hardwick resided in North Rich Woods, Greene, Illinois, USA. In 1850, Willis Hardwick resided in Between Macoupin and Apple Creeks, Greene, Illinoi. Willis Hardwick married Anna Scoggins, and had children including Charles Augustus Hardwick, Charlotte L Hardwick, George Washington Hardwick, James H Hardwick, Lucy Hardwick, Mary Ann Scoggins, Seborn Wesley Hardwick. Willis Hardwick passed away in 1866 in Woody, Greene County, Illinois, United States of America.
